Mediation offers a compelling avenue for resolving disputes peacefully. A skilled mediator moderates communication between individuals, helping them identify their needs and explore mutually beneficial solutions. Through honest dialogue and collaborative problem-solving, mediation seeks to repair relationships and attain a lasting outcome.

The method of mediation is dynamic, customizing itself to the unique circumstances of each situation. This versatility allows mediators to successfully handle a diverse spectrum of issues, from family conflicts to commercial disputes.

Improving Your Legal Process with ADR

ADR approaches present a compelling alternative to traditional litigation for settling legal disputes. By facilitating communication and negotiation between parties, ADR systems can often obtain mutually acceptable outcomes in a {moreefficient manner. This simplifies the legal process, lowering costs and safeguarding relationships.

A variety of ADR tools are available, including mediation, arbitration, and negotiation. Each approach has its own advantages and fitness for different types of cases. Experienced ADR practitioners can assist parties in choosing the most appropriate process to fulfill their needs.

Unlocking Settlement: The Power of Alternative Dispute Resolution

In an increasingly complex and polarized legal landscape, traditional litigation can often prove to be a lengthy, costly, and emotionally draining process. Fortunately, emerging as a viable alternative is the field of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R). ADR encompasses a variety of methods designed to facilitate amicable outcomes, sparing parties the often-grueling experience of court proceedings. From mediation to arbitration, ADR offers a range of tools tailored to diverse conflicts, enabling individuals to reach mutually agreeable solutions while preserving relationships and minimizing financial burdens.
